Dorothy Bret for U.S.
PA Auckland Dorothy Bret ended her New Zealand racing career on a winning note when she scored handsomely in the Wild Nut Mobile Pace at the Thames Trotting Club’s meeting at Alexandra Park last Friday night. The four-year-old mare will be taken to the United States on Saturday. Dorothy Bret was, trained by Noel Taylor, of Auckland, and raced by him in partnership with Mrs Jewel Pierce, of Invercargill. The pair will continue to race the Knowing Bret mare. She will join Jack Sherren’s California stable along with several other horses owned by Mr Taylor. Mr Taylor also intends to send Nyallo Skipper, Pony Express, Final Call and the South Island pacer, Lili’s Choice. Jack Sherren has had considerable success with New Zealand-bred pacers in North America. He recently won the Guys and Dolls series final at Freehold, in California, with Spinster Anna, which was bred byMr Taylor.
